Question - After a wedding in 2020, ten people died, possibly as a result of food poisoning from products sold by the enterprise. Legal proceedings have commenced, seeking damages from enterprise but it disputes liability. Up to the date of the authorization of the financial statements for the year ended December 31, 2020, the enterprise's lawyers advised that it is probable that it will not be found liable.

However, when the enterprise prepares the financial statements for the year ended December 31, 2021, its lawyers advice that, owing to developments in the case, it is probable that it will be found liable.

What is the proper disposition for the foregoing facts for the years 2020 and 2021?

a. 2020- No provision, may disclose as a contingent liability; 2021- provision

b. 2020- No provision; 2021- no provision, may disclose as contingent liability

c. 2020- Provision, best estimate; 2016- Provision, adjusted for the best estimate

d. 2020- Provision; 2016- no provision
